I'm afraid I have not read the article myself, but would like to point out a hole in "direct correlations" like this. correlations do not equate to a cause and effect. any scientist worth their salt knows this. Having been fascinated by hemispheric asymettry as a student I simply love this subject! The only thing I have noticed amongst my many left handed buddies is a)better spatial ability, and b)bad spelling. Because "most" lefties are right-hemisphere dominant, the general consensus is (or at least used to be, back when I was researching it) that they have a harder time with language (left hemisphere) and an easier time with colours , geometry and creativity (right hemisphere). On a juggling note, I know that some lefties can pick up the damn tricks a lot more easily, and as well as getting more practice against righties in fencing than we do against them, timing and being able to predict and visualise actions better in their brains.
